This week Megan and Dave tackle AMERICAN DREAMER (2:07), and it ain’t pretty. Sure, Peter Dinklage and Shirley MacLaine are fine. And sure, Dave laughed at a few things. But that’s about all the positives we have for it (hoo boy, do we get amped up during this talk!). Then Evan, Megan, and Dave watched DAMSEL (22:40), the new dragon’s-gonna-eat-ya-but-not-if-I-can-help-it flick starring Millie Bobby Brown as a princess who meets said dragon after a bit of marital subterfuge orchestrated by Robin Wright as her nefarious would-be mother-in-law. Following an uneven opening, we thought it pulled together (even if Dave had some choice things to say about his favorite actor ever, Ray Winstone, who plays Brown’s father). And did we like DAMSEL as much as we liked the similar-ish THE PRINCESS from 2022? Over on Patreon, we talk about the 1954 GODZILLA in honor of its 70th anniversary.
